The invention relates to a suction bucket (30) for a seabed foundation for an offshore facility. The suction bucket (30) is arranged for being embedded into a marine sediment (22). The suction bucket (30) comprises a lid (31) and a sidewall (32). The sidewall (32) is segmented into a first circumferential segment (35) and at least a second circumferential segment (36). The first circumferential segment (35) is connected with the second circumferential segment (36). The first circumferential segment (35) and the second circumferential segment (36) are attached to the lid (31) of the suction bucket (30). Furthermore, the first circumferential segment (35) and the second circumferential segment (36) each contains at least one substantially planar section. Furthermore, the invention relates to a method to manufacture a suction bucket (30) for a seabed foundation for an offshore facility.
